What is the Net Worth Of Kevin Gates in 2025?
As of 2025, Kevin Gates’ net worth is estimated at $2 million. While this figure is lower compared to some of his industry peers, it reflects his independent approach to music.
Unlike artists who rely solely on major labels, Gates has built his fortune through his record label, Bread Winners’ Association, and strategic business ventures.
When compared to other hip-hop artists, Gates’ wealth is modest. For instance, Boosie Badazz and Webbie, who were instrumental in his early career, have seen varied financial success.
Nonetheless, Kevin Gates continues to earn through album sales, touring, and investments.

Kevin Gates Wealth, Salary and Financial Overview
How Much Does He Earn Per Year?
Kevin Gates’ annual earnings come from multiple streams, including music sales, streaming, touring, and business ventures. His income fluctuates based on album releases and concert schedules.
- Album and Streaming Revenue: His debut studio album, Islah, sold 112,000 copies in its first week, providing a significant payday. His songs like “2 Phones” and “Really Really” generate steady royalties from streaming platforms.
- Touring Revenue: Kevin Gates has embarked on multiple tours, where ticket sales and merchandise add to his yearly income.
- Endorsements & Business: Although he’s not known for major brand endorsements, he profits from his energy drink, #IDGT, and record label earnings.

How Did He Build His Wealth?
Kevin Gates’ rise to financial success was not instant. His early years in Baton Rouge were filled with struggles, but he found a way to turn his passion for music into a career.
- Independent Music Strategy: Unlike many mainstream artists, he relied on his own record label rather than a traditional major-label deal.
- Consistent Releases: His success with mixtapes like Stranger Than Fiction and By Any Means laid the groundwork for his later albums.
- Smart Business Moves: Gates created multiple revenue streams beyond music, ensuring long-term financial security.

What Role Does Touring Play in His Finances?
Touring is one of the most profitable aspects of Kevin Gates’ career. He has headlined multiple tours, including:
- I Don’t Get Tired Tour
- By Any Means Tour
- Islah Tour
Concerts provide ticket sales, merchandise sales, and VIP experiences, making them a crucial income stream.
